I'm a a long time AMG fan and despite not having a proper capacity engine or enough cylinders this thing really does feel special.
The engineering is really quite phenomenal with the engine, gearbox, suspension. and AWD system all being bespoke to the 45.
It really is remarkably quick point to point, genuine supercar threatening pace and eats brakes far less than all its bigger brothers did. Chomps tyres mind and I ruined a set inside 4k miles with a big driving trip this year.
Noise is better with the Milltek but it still sounds pretty crap.
Engine is a marvel though, just over 420 bhp, plenty torque and it revs high for a turbo which makes it fun.
Highly recommended
